The Dior Coat: A Reflection of the House's Philosophy
“I personally don’t like seeing a woman in the city without a coat,” Christian Dior famously declared in his *Little Dictionary of Fashion*. This simple statement reveals a deep understanding of the coat’s importance in completing an ensemble, elevating an outfit from ordinary to extraordinary. For Dior, the coat wasn't merely functional; it was an integral part of a woman's overall aesthetic, a chance to showcase personality and sophistication. This philosophy permeates every Dior coat, regardless of the era or style.
The early Dior coats, born from the revolutionary New Look in 1947, were characterized by their cinched waists, full skirts, and opulent fabrics. These designs, often crafted from luxurious materials like wool, cashmere, and silk, exuded an air of refined elegance, reflecting the post-war yearning for glamour and femininity. The iconic Bar jacket, while not strictly a coat, shared the same emphasis on meticulous tailoring and luxurious fabrics, setting the stage for the future of Dior outerwear.
The evolution of the Dior coat has been a journey through fashion history, reflecting the changing styles and sensibilities of each era. From the structured silhouettes of the 1950s and 60s to the more relaxed and modern designs of subsequent decades, the Dior coat has consistently maintained its position as a hallmark of high fashion. The house’s commitment to exceptional quality and impeccable tailoring remains a constant, ensuring that each piece is a testament to the enduring legacy of Christian Dior.
Dior Coats for Women: A Spectrum of Style
The Dior women's coat collection offers a breathtaking array of styles, catering to diverse tastes and occasions. From classic trench coats to bold statement pieces, there's a Dior coat to suit every woman's personal style and wardrobe needs.
* Classic and Timeless: The classic Dior coat, often featuring a tailored silhouette and sophisticated detailing, remains a staple of the collection. These coats, usually crafted from high-quality wool or cashmere, are designed to transcend fleeting trends, offering timeless elegance and lasting value. Neutral colors like beige, navy, and black are popular choices, allowing for versatility and effortless integration into various outfits.
* Modern and Edgy: Dior also embraces contemporary designs, incorporating modern silhouettes and unexpected details. Asymmetrical cuts, bold colors, and innovative textures are often featured in these more avant-garde pieces. These coats, while still retaining the hallmark Dior quality, offer a more playful and experimental approach to outerwear.
